What’s exactly a black hole?

In case you are not very sure about what black holes are, they are places in the universe that absorb everything from light to time. Nothing can escape from them! They are called black holes because we cannot see them. Until now, it was believed that whatever got to black holes would never come back. According to Albert Einstein, the law of physics doesn’t work as we thought in these places.

White holes

Even though they are named ‘white holes’ it doesn’t mean they are white, the reason behind its name is they are opposite to black holes in what they do. White holes don’t absorb everything that comes into its path, but they expel it.

White holes are not something new, there have been references about them in mathematics since Einstein times, but now is when scientists are closer to conclude the white holes theory.

NASA’s advanced technology

These black holes need specific technology to be seen and here is when NASA makes use of its technology. Scientists have created special telescopes to capture what happens in their surroundings. Let’s talk about the three telescopes used in this study:

  • The Chandra X-ray Observatory: this telescope captures x-ray near black holes thanks to the emission of x-ray coming from near dust and gas.
  • Hubble Space and James Webb Telescopes: these are used to see galaxies and some of them contain a supermassive black hole inside. The Hubble captures visible light and the James Webb captures far away and dark things.
